Baird Financial Group Inc. Purchases 63,009 Shares of TechnipFMC plc (NYSE:FTI)

TechnipFMC logo with Energy background

Baird Financial Group Inc. raised its position in shares of TechnipFMC plc (NYSE:FTI - Free Report) by 92.2% in the fourth quarter, according to the company in its most recent filing with the Securities & Exchange Commission. The institutional investor owned 131,376 shares of the oil and gas company's stock after purchasing an additional 63,009 shares during the period. Baird Financial Group Inc.'s holdings in TechnipFMC were worth $3,802,000 as of its most recent filing with the Securities & Exchange Commission.

Other hedge funds have also made changes to their positions in the company. Ameriprise Financial Inc. grew its holdings in TechnipFMC by 31.5% during the 4th quarter. Ameriprise Financial Inc. now owns 16,538,230 shares of the oil and gas company's stock worth $478,620,000 after acquiring an additional 3,962,315 shares in the last quarter. Norges Bank purchased a new stake in shares of TechnipFMC in the 4th quarter worth approximately $96,808,000. Anomaly Capital Management LP lifted its position in shares of TechnipFMC by 46.5% in the 4th quarter. Anomaly Capital Management LP now owns 7,266,580 shares of the oil and gas company's stock worth $210,295,000 after purchasing an additional 2,306,342 shares during the period. AQR Capital Management LLC increased its holdings in TechnipFMC by 70.6% during the fourth quarter. AQR Capital Management LLC now owns 4,132,758 shares of the oil and gas company's stock valued at $119,602,000 after buying an additional 1,710,183 shares during the period. Finally, Vanguard Group Inc. raised its stake in TechnipFMC by 4.1% in the fourth quarter. Vanguard Group Inc. now owns 40,793,925 shares of the oil and gas company's stock worth $1,180,576,000 after buying an additional 1,623,864 shares in the last quarter. 96.58% of the stock is currently owned by hedge funds and other institutional investors.

TechnipFMC Stock Performance

Shares of FTI stock opened at $29.90 on Friday. The business has a fifty day moving average of $27.60 and a 200 day moving average of $29.10. TechnipFMC plc has a 1 year low of $22.12 and a 1 year high of $33.45. The company has a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.22, a current ratio of 1.14 and a quick ratio of 0.89. The firm has a market capitalization of $12.53 billion, a price-to-earnings ratio of 19.67 and a beta of 0.98.

TechnipFMC (NYSE:FTI - Get Free Report) last announced its quarterly earnings data on Thursday, April 24th. The oil and gas company reported $0.33 ear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, missing the consensus estimate of $0.36 by ($0.03). The firm had revenue of $2.23 billion during the quarter, compared to analysts' expectations of $2.26 billion. TechnipFMC had a return on equity of 20.11% and a net margin of 7.63%. The company's revenue for the quarter was up 9.4% compared to the same quarter last year. During the same quarter in the previous year, the business earned $0.22 earnings per share. As a group, research analysts expect that TechnipFMC plc will post 1.63 earnings per share for the current year.

TechnipFMC Dividend Announcement

The firm also recently disclosed a quarterly dividend, which will be paid on Wednesday, June 4th. Stockholders of record on Tuesday, May 20th will be issued a $0.05 dividend. This represents a $0.20 annualized dividend and a dividend yield of 0.67%. The ex-dividend date is Tuesday, May 20th. TechnipFMC's dividend payout ratio (DPR) is currently 10.53%.

Insider Activity

In other news, CAO David Light sold 10,147 shares of the business's stock in a transaction dated Tuesday, March 11th. The stock was sold at an average price of $24.90, for a total value of $252,660.30. Following the completion of the transaction, the chief accounting officer now owns 7,529 shares of the company's stock, valued at $187,472.10. The trade was a 57.41 % decrease in their position. The sale was disclosed in a filing with the SEC, which is available through the SEC website. Also, EVP Justin Rounce sold 42,178 shares of the firm's stock in a transaction dated Wednesday, March 12th. The stock was sold at an average price of $26.55, for a total value of $1,119,825.90. Following the sale, the executive vice president now directly owns 140,207 shares in the company, valued at approximately $3,722,495.85. This trade represents a 23.13 % decrease in their ownership of the stock. The disclosure for this sale can be found here. Insiders have sold 61,706 shares of company stock valued at $1,651,665 in the last ninety days. Insiders own 1.80% of the company's stock.

Analyst Ratings Changes

A number of research analysts have recently issued reports on FTI shares. Royal Bank of Canada reiterated an "outperform" rating and issued a $37.00 price target on shares of TechnipFMC in a report on Monday, April 28th. Evercore ISI lifted their target price on TechnipFMC from $37.00 to $39.00 and gave the company an "outperform" rating in a research note on Wednesday, January 15th. Susquehanna reduced their target price on shares of TechnipFMC from $41.00 to $35.00 and set a "positive" rating for the company in a report on Monday, April 14th. Piper Sandler raised their price target on shares of TechnipFMC from $39.00 to $40.00 and gave the company an "overweight" rating in a report on Friday, February 28th. Finally, StockNews.com lowered shares of TechnipFMC from a "buy" rating to a "hold" rating in a research note on Thursday, March 27th. Two research analysts have rated the stock with a hold rating, eleven have issued a buy rating and one has assigned a strong buy rating to the stock. According to MarketBeat, the company presently has an average rating of "Moderate Buy" and an average price target of $36.83.

TechnipFMC Profile

(Free Report)

TechnipFMC plc engages in the energy projects, technologies, and systems and services businesses in Europe, Central Asia, North America, Latin America, the Asia Pacific, Africa, the Middle East, and internationally. It operates through two segments: Subsea and Surface Technologies. The Subsea segment engages in the design, engineering, procurement, manufacturing, fabrication, installation, and life of field services for subsea systems, subsea field infrastructure, and subsea pipe systems used in oil and gas production and transportation.
